Let’s work hard, but also have fun with it. When I went to orthodontic school, we got zero training in marketing. Actually, when I got out of school 18 years ago, it was kind of taboo to actually do any marketing. The most you could do is put your name in the yellow pages, but now it’s pretty common knowledge and pretty mainstream to go ahead and get your name out there. Tell everyone about your story, who you are, and what you’re about. If you don’t do that, it’s a leg of your business that you’re lacking. You will end up behind because you can be the best orthodontist or the best whatever, but if people don’t know that, then you won’t get the customers coming in.
